This one was inspired by this picture and colour combination. I am absolutely not a purple person so this was really hard for me! I am pleased with the results though.



I've also used that die cut-out trick from Stretch Your Stamps too, just to give the card a little extra something. And I inked up the butterflies a new way (for me!). I squidged some Elegant Eggplant and Wisteria Wonder inks onto my Teflon craft sheet, then spritzed it with Perfect Pearls mist. Then I inked up the stamp. It was pretty watery but I kind of like the splodgy results. (So many technical terms today, I hope you're keeping up!)
